Ham and Cheese omelette

Image by Pahz
Just a basic omelette. I had this for lunch today. The recipe can be increased or decreased as needed. Since this was just for me I used three eggs. Beat the eggs with a splash of milk and pour into a hot (medium-high heat) frying pan sprayed with Pam (or oil, or butter, whichever you prefer).
When the eggs start to cook, I add diced ham (today, I cut it into strips instead of cubes). Then I sprinkled generously with shredded sharp cheddar cheese. Just as it looks about done, I take it from the stovetop and put the skillet into the oven with the broil setting on. Just for a few moments, to melt the cheese all the way through and to brown the eggs ever-so-slightly.
Don’t leave it in there long- less than two minutes at the most. Then, back on the stovetop to use a spatula to flip half of the now cooked omelette onto itself.
Then, gently slide onto a waiting plate and enjoy!
I’ve made this same omelette in a larger frying pan with as many as six eggs. I’ve also used pepperoni and mozzarella, or even diced up hot dogs and Velveeta cheese.
